Technical Specifications
-
Motor Type: Brushed DC gear motor with encoder
-
Nominal Voltage: 12V DC
-
Gear Ratio: 43.7:1
-
No-load Speed: 251 RPM
-
Rated Speed (approx): 204 RPM
-
No-load Current: ~0.35 A
-
Stall Current: ~7 A
-
Rated Torque: ~45 oz·in
-
Stall Torque: ~250 oz·in / 18 kg·cm
-
Encoder: Hall-effect quadrature type (16 counts per motor revolution ≈700 counts at output shaft)
-
Shaft: 6 mm D-shaped, 15 mm long
-
Dimensions: 37 mm diameter × 53 mm length
-
Weight: ~205 g
